Linux môže byť 32-bitový alebo 64-bitový v závislosti od architektúry procesora. 32-bitovú verziu systému Linux možno používať na procesoroch x86 a ARM, zatiaľ čo 64-bitovú verziu možno používať na procesoroch x64 a ARM64. V súčasnosti väčšina nových počítačov a serverov používa 64-bitové verzie systému Linux.
Čo je to bitovosť systému?

Bitovosť systému Linux sa vzťahuje na jeho schopnosť spracovávať údaje a je určená počtom bitov v centrálnej procesorovej jednotke (CPU). Bitovosť môže byť 32-bitová alebo 64-bitová. 32-bitový systém dokáže spracovať len 32-bitové údaje, zatiaľ čo 64-bitový systém dokáže spracovať 32-bitové aj 64-bitové údaje. Bitovosť systému ovplyvňuje jeho výkon, spotrebu energie, veľkosť pamäte a ďalšie parametre.
Čo to dáva?
Bitovosť systému Linux (32-bitová alebo 64-bitová) určuje, koľko údajov dokáže procesor spracovať za jeden takt, ako aj maximálnu veľkosť adresovateľnej pamäte. Tu sú uvedené hlavné aspekty, ktoré ovplyvňuje:
- Adresovateľná veľkosť pamäte: 32-bitové systémy môžu adresovať až 4 GB RAM (2^32 bajtov), zatiaľ čo 64-bitové systémy môžu spracovať oveľa väčšie množstvo (teoreticky až 16 EB, v praxi v moderných systémoch až niekoľko terabajtov).
- Výkon: 64-bitové aplikácie môžu spracovať viac údajov na jeden takt, čo môže viesť k vyššiemu výkonu, najmä pri práci s veľkým množstvom údajov.
- Kompatibilita: niektoré programy môžu byť k dispozícii len v 64-bitovej verzii, čo obmedzuje používanie 32-bitových systémov pre nové aplikácie.
- Využitie registrov: 64-bitové systémy majú viac registrov procesora, čo môže zvýšiť efektivitu vykonávania programu.
- Podpora moderných technológií: nové technológie a funkcie, ako sú rozšírené inštrukcie a vylepšené zabezpečenie, sú často dostupné len v 64-bitových verziách.
Výber bitovosti systému môže mať významný vplyv na výkon, funkcie a kompatibilitu softvéru.
Prečo potrebujem poznať bitovosť systému Linux?
Znalosť bitovosti systému Linux je dôležitá pre pochopenie a výber správnej verzie softvéru. Napríklad program vytvorený pre 32-bitový systém nemusí fungovať v 64-bitovom systéme a naopak. Okrem toho vám znalosť bitovej kapacity pomôže určiť maximálnu podporovanú pamäť RAM a procesor, čo je dôležité pri výbere a aktualizácii počítača.
Pozrite si bitovú kapacitu v termináli
Návod je jednoduchý:
- Otvorte terminál stlačením klávesovej skratky Ctrl+Alt+T.
- Napíšte príkaz uname -m a stlačte kláves Enter.
- Zobrazí sa odpoveď v podobe architektúry vášho systému. Ak je v riadku odpovede uvedené x86_64, znamená to, že máte 64-bitový Linux. Ak je v riadku odpovede uvedené i386, i486, i586 alebo i686, znamená to, že máte 32-bitový Linux.
- Môžete tiež použiť príkaz getconf LONG_BIT, ktorý vám ukáže aktuálnu bitovosť systému. Ak je výstup 32, znamená to, že máte 32-bitový Linux, ak je 64, znamená to, že máte 64-bitový Linux.
Je dôležité si uvedomiť, že na to, aby ste mohli používať 64-bitový Linux, musíte mať procesor, ktorý je tiež 64-bitový.
V Ubuntu na to potrebujete otvoriť nástroj Nastavenia a potom časť o systéme:

V časti Typ operačného systému sa uvádza architektúra systému, ktorá je v tomto prípade 64-bitová. Nemali by ste však zabúdať, že prítomnosť 64-bitovej architektúry neznamená, že nie je možné spúšťať 32-bitové aplikácie a knižnice. Vďaka spätnej kompatibilite tejto architektúry sú procesory stále schopné vykonávať úlohy určené pre 32-bitový systém.
Na tento účel je potrebné nainštalovať príslušnú sadu ovládačov a potrebné 32-bitové knižnice. Spätná kompatibilita však nefunguje opačne: 32-bitové systémy nemôžu spúšťať 64-bitové aplikácie. Teraz máte vedomosti, ktoré vám pomôžu určiť bitovosť vášho systému Linux.